Keep Fire 2 is an indie adventure FPS focused on monster defense. Players team up to survive endless waves of enemies across multiple maps built in Unreal Engine 5. The core loop centers on coordinated defense, weapon customization, and class-based abilities that encourage varied squad compositions.
Gameplay
The experience revolves around defending positions against successive monster waves in tuned environments. Each weapon ties directly to a specialized class that grants unique abilities, allowing players to mix roles such as support, damage, or utility when forming groups of up to five. Attachments modify weapons through the gunsmith system, letting users adjust recoil, damage output, or handling to match individual preferences. Character cosmetics provide extensive options for visual distinction without affecting mechanics. Seamless multiplayer supports inviting Steam friends for joint sessions, where teamwork determines success against stronger foes. Additional maps enter rotation over time, introducing new landscapes and enemy behaviors that refresh the defensive challenges.
Game Modes
Core play involves surviving continuous monster waves in shared worlds. Sessions emphasize endurance and coordination rather than competitive scoring or story progression. Players select classes and loadouts before each engagement, then adapt strategies as waves intensify. The design supports both smaller groups and full five-player teams, with maps scaled to maintain pressure regardless of squad size. Ongoing map additions expand the available defensive scenarios without altering the fundamental wave-survival structure.
Customization and Progression
Loadout building combines class selection with gunsmith modifications to create specialized kits. Cosmetic choices allow full character personalization, helping squads identify roles at a glance during intense fights. These systems interconnect with the multiplayer framework, where a balanced team composition often outperforms individual skill.
